What is a Madagascar DVD ISO?
An ISO file (often called an ISO image) is a perfect digital clone of an optical disc. When you create or download a Madagascar DVD ISO, you are not just getting the video file. You are getting the entire structure of the DVD.
Main Feature: The full animated movie in its original standard-definition quality.
Audio & Subtitles: All original language tracks and subtitle options.
Menus: The interactive DVD menus used to select scenes and setups.
Bonus Content: Behind-the-scenes footage, director commentaries, and interactive games included on the physical release. Why Use a DVD ISO for Madagascar?
There are several reasons why collectors and movie fans prefer keeping their media in ISO format rather than ripping them to standard MP4 or MKV files. 1. Flawless Preservation
Physical DVDs degrade over time due to scratches, heat, or "disc rot." Converting your purchased Madagascar DVD into an ISO file creates a permanent digital backup that will never skip or fail. 2. The Complete DVD Experience madagascar dvd iso
When you compress a DVD into an MP4 file, you usually lose the menus and bonus features. An ISO file retains everything. You can click through the menus exactly as if the disc were spinning in a physical player. 3. Easy Digital Storage
Modern computers and laptops rarely come with built-in disc drives. Storing your movie collection as ISO files on a hard drive or Network Attached Storage (NAS) system makes them easily accessible across your home network. How to Open and Play a Madagascar DVD ISO
Playing an ISO file is simple on modern operating systems. You do not need to burn it back to a physical disc to watch it. Desktop Media Players
VLC Media Player: The most popular free, open-source media player. You can simply drag and drop the Madagascar ISO file directly into VLC, and it will play complete with functional menus.
Kodi: A fantastic option if you are building a home theater PC. Kodi organizes ISO files beautifully and emulates DVD playback perfectly. Native OS Mounting
Windows 10/11 & macOS: You can right-click the ISO file and select Mount. Your computer will treat the file as if you just inserted a real DVD into a non-existent disc drive. You can then play it with any standard DVD player software. How to Create Your Own Madagascar ISO

Insert the Disc: Place your Madagascar DVD into an external or internal DVD drive.
Use DVD Ripping Software: Download a trusted, free program like ImgBurn (for Windows) or use Disk Utility (on Mac).
Read to Image: Select the option to "Create image file from disc" or "Read disc."
Save as ISO: Choose your destination folder, ensure the output format is set to .iso, and let the software clone the disc. A Note on Legalities and Safety
While discussing ISO files, it is crucial to address the legal and safety landscape surrounding digital media.
Copyright Laws: In many jurisdictions, making a backup copy of a DVD you personally own for private use falls under fair use or specific format-shifting exceptions. However, downloading a Madagascar DVD ISO from public torrent sites or file-sharing hubs violates copyright laws.
Malware Risks: Sites offering free downloads of movie ISO files are notorious for hosting malware, adware, and phishing scams. To protect your computer, always stick to ripping your own legally purchased media. Common Problems & Troubleshooting If you are having
Common Problems & Troubleshooting
If you are having trouble with your Madagascar DVD ISO, you might face these issues:
Problem: "Cannot open disc. No valid source found."
- Solution: The ISO is corrupted, or it has CSS encryption that your player can't bypass. Use a decrypter like MakeMKV or AnyDVD to create a decrypted ISO.
Problem: The ISO plays the movie but no menus.
- Solution: Your player (e.g., basic Windows Media Player) lacks full DVD navigation. Switch to VLC or Kodi, and ensure you open the disc as a DVD, not as a video file.
Problem: The video looks pixelated or blocky.
- Solution: That’s standard DVD quality. DVDs are 720x480 pixels (NTSC) or 720x576 (PAL). For HD, you would need a Madagascar Blu-ray ISO (1080p), which is a different purchase.
